[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Don't colleges just look at overall GPA? I don't think they have time to weed through every detail from 9th on... I believe every school has a minimum GPA and if you have it you have a chance.[/quote] Not at all. The courses taken and grades received are very important. A kid with 10 APs and a 4.0uw and a kid with regular classes and as many electives as possible and a 4.0uw are not going to end up at the same schools, even if they have the same test score. This is why you see so many people on here whining that their straight A student was rejected from Virginia Tech and they just don’t know why. [/quote]
